linux下安裝redis步驟詳解

redis安裝有很多種方式,對於linux安裝來說,可以使用wget下載對應的redis安裝包進行安裝配置。詳細過程如下

1,安裝wget::yum install wget
在這裏插入圖片描述
2,進入官網,找到對應的下載路徑:https://redis.io/download
在這裏插入圖片描述
上面已經給出了linux安裝的關鍵步驟,拿出鏈接即可。
3,下載安裝包並解壓:

   # wget http://download.redis.io/releases/redis-5.0.4.tar.gz`
   # tar xzf redis-5.0.4.tar.gz

在這裏插入圖片描述
4,進入解壓後文件根目錄,執行make命令編譯。
在這裏插入圖片描述
此時會報一個這個錯:gcc: Command not found,這是因爲沒有安裝gcc,我們安裝一下gcc即可。

[root@baomw-centos2 redis-5.0.4]# yum install gcc

安裝完gcc之後再次執行make命令還是會報一個如下的錯,
在這裏插入圖片描述
執行:make MALLOC=libc即可
在這裏插入圖片描述
5,編譯完成後,進入src(cd src/)目錄執行:make install 安裝即可
在這裏插入圖片描述
執行redis-server 出現如下日誌圖案,說明redis啓動成功,安裝完成。
在這裏插入圖片描述
如圖,可見redis已經可以正常工作了
在這裏插入圖片描述
但是一般情況下,安裝到這裏並沒有結束,當然,你可以直接在安裝目錄去做redis的啓停操作,但是真正生產使用過程中,會爲了便於管理操作,會建立自己的目錄,然後去管理redis。需要規劃redis配置文件,具體如下:
在這裏插入圖片描述
如圖,在安裝目錄的同級目錄建一個redis-db1的目錄,因爲redis啓動主要依據配置文件,如果我要在一臺機器上啓用多個redis,只需要cp多個配置文件即可。
然後再redis-db1下建三個文件夾,分別是
bin:啓動命令(服務端和客戶端等)

mv redis-benchmark redis-check-aof redis-cli redis-server /home/redis/redis-db1/bin/

etc:配置文件redis.conf

mv /home/redis/redis-5.0.4/redis.conf /home/redis/redis-db1/etc/

db:持久化文件

然後啓動服務端的時候,只需要根據bin下的redis-server和etc下的redis.conf啓動即可。

[root@baomw-centos2 redis-db1]# bin/redis-server etc/redis.conf 

在這裏插入圖片描述
如上redis的一個基本安裝就算完成了,至於詳細配置這裏不做說明,有興趣可自行查閱相關資料。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章